Destination Unknown: improving transitions for care leavers and young people with SEND

A lack of consistent and effective transition support for vulnerable young people when they turn 18 is leading to unacceptable poor outcomes, a new report has found.

Titled ‘Destination Unknown’, the Children’s Services Development Group’s (CSDG) report sets out the “cliff edge in support” care leavers and young people with special educational needs and disabilities (SEND) face when they leave care or specialist education, and the huge detriment this can have to their life outcomes.
